Want to see how the ITER project is progressing? Curious to learn more about the fusion process? Individual and group tours of the ITER site are now available and coordinated by the newly established Joint Visit Team in Cadarache. Drawing resources from F4E, ITER IO and Agence ITER France, the Joint Visit Team currently offers tours in English, French and Spanish.
Tours are made-to-measure depending on interests of the visitors and are available during Monday to Friday, from 9 am to 7 pm. To ensure an optimal visit, appointments should be made 3 days before you would like to tour the site.
